Footprint-only vs Footprint + CRP — which do you need?
The cheapest way to scope this is to start from the trigger, not the deliverable. If a customer has asked for your emissions number, you're applying for B Corp or EcoVadis, or you simply want to disclose voluntarily, you need a GHG Protocol-aligned carbon footprint covering Scope 1, 2 and material Scope 3. That's a standalone deliverable — director-signed, ready to hand to the customer or upload to a disclosure portal. No Carbon Reduction Plan required.
If your driver is a UK central government tender above the £5m threshold, an NHS Supply Chain bid or a Crown Commercial Service framework, you need both: the carbon footprint and a PPN 006-compliant Carbon Reduction Plan built on top of it. The CRP cannot exist without the footprint — every credible consultant on this list scopes the two together for tender-driven projects. SECR is a separate annual disclosure that only kicks in once you cross the large-company threshold (250 staff, £36m turnover or £18m balance sheet — meeting two of three).

2. Green Business (Green Small Business)
What they do: SME-only UK consultancy offering carbon footprints, PPN 006 Carbon Reduction Plans, third-party verification and the proprietary Green Business Certification, positioned as an ISO 14001 alternative for SMEs without in-house sustainability staff. green.business
Differentiators: One of the few UK SME providers with a transparent published pricing tool (footprints from £599+VAT); 300+ SMEs supported; Green Business Certification offered as an SME-friendly alternative to ISO 14001; entirely human-led with no platform lock-in.
Best fit: Micro and small SMEs (typically under 25 staff) whose primary decision driver is published price visibility and a recognisable certification mark alongside their carbon report.
3. Litmus Sustainability
What they do: UK net-zero consultancy specialising in PPN 006 Carbon Reduction Plans for SMEs bidding on central government and NHS contracts, supported by a 12-part self-serve CRP masterclass that doubles as a lead funnel. litmussustainability.com
Differentiators: Strong content-led presence around PPN 006; explicit "bid-winning" positioning; pairs done-for-you consultancy with self-serve education for cost-sensitive SMEs; deep familiarity with how government procurement teams read and score CRPs.
Best fit: Bid and proposal teams who want a consultant who lives and breathes PPN 006 evaluation criteria, particularly for central government and NHS frameworks.
4. SBS (Sustainability for Business Solutions)
What they do: Acts as an outsourced sustainability team for UK SMEs, delivering GHG Protocol / ISO 14064 / PPN 006 / SBTi-aligned footprints, CRPs and verification, framed around supply-chain and tender-readiness pressure. sbs.eco
Differentiators: Embeds with the client team; bundles Carbon Literacy training, Scope 3 and energy procurement into a single programme; free Net-Zero Scorecard entry point. For SMEs with multiple ongoing sustainability obligations — SECR, SBTi commitments, supply chain disclosures — the bundled model starts to make economic sense over commissioning individual projects.
Best fit: SMEs who want ongoing fractional sustainability support over 12+ months rather than a single deliverable.
5. ecollective
What they do: Sector-specialist SME carbon consultancy producing footprints and SBTi / PPN 006-aligned reduction plans with a "no waffle" reporting style and Carbon Literacy training. ecollectivecarbon.com
Differentiators: Deep specialism in travel, food and events sectors — industries where Scope 3 emissions from supply chains, transport and food production dominate the footprint and where generic methodology rarely holds up. A generalist consultant will often misclassify emissions or apply the wrong factors for highly sector-specific activities.
Best fit: SMEs in hospitality, travel, food and events who need a consultant familiar with the specific Scope 3 categories that dominate their footprint.
6. C Free
What they do: UK environmental consultancy specialising in carbon footprint calculations and Carbon Reduction Plans for NHS framework suppliers — a specific niche where procurement authority requirements can differ in emphasis from standard PPN 006. c-free.co.uk
Differentiators: Strong NHS supplier specialism; bespoke data dashboards as part of delivery; published testimonials concentrated in NHS Supply Chain and consumer-goods sectors. NHS Supply Chain bidding has its own evaluation weighting that a generalist may not navigate as efficiently.
Best fit: SMEs whose entire commercial reason for a CRP is a current or upcoming NHS Supply Chain or Crown Commercial Service bid.

Hybrid (SaaS + consultancy) firms
These four firms combine a software platform with consultancy support. They suit SMEs who want an ongoing reporting environment or whose accountants already use Xero, Sage or QuickBooks. For most one-off PPN 006 requirements, platform subscriptions cost more annually than a fixed-fee consultancy — but if you're reporting year-on-year and tracking reduction targets, the ongoing environment adds value.
7. NetZero Group (NetScope platform)
What they do: UK consultancy combining the NetScope SaaS platform with senior consultants to deliver PPN 006 CRPs, SECR, TCFD, Greener NHS reporting and SBTi-aligned roadmaps across public- and private-sector supply chains. netzero.co.uk
Differentiators: Explicit sector pages for manufacturing and NHS; hundreds of PPN 006 CRPs delivered; combines software and human expertise. The platform-plus-consultancy model means you get a persistent data environment for ongoing SECR or annual reporting alongside your CRP.
Best fit: Mid-market SMEs (100+ staff) who need both a one-off CRP and an ongoing reporting environment, particularly in manufacturing or NHS supply chains.
8. EcoHedge
What they do: UK-built carbon accounting SaaS that pulls data from Xero, QuickBooks and Sage, generates GHG Protocol Scope 1/2/3 reports, and offers PPN 006-compliant Carbon Reduction Plans as a paid consultancy add-on. ecohedge.com
Differentiators: Sub-10-minute onboarding; native Xero / Sage / QuickBooks integrations removing much of the manual data collection burden; 277,000+ emission factors; sector pages for manufacturing, construction and agriculture. Note that the PPN 006 CRP is a paid add-on, not included in the platform.
Best fit: Small businesses already running finances on a cloud accounting platform who want to bolt carbon reporting onto that workflow.
9. Seedling
What they do: All-in-one carbon accounting and Net Zero planning platform for businesses up to 2,000 FTEs, with SECR, B Corp, EcoVadis and PPN 006 reporting templates and a named carbon expert per client. seedling.earth
Differentiators: Activity-based methodology; ISO 14064 aligned; CRP turnaround claimed in under four weeks; named expert per client (unusual for the SaaS category); channel partnerships with UK accountancy firms.
Best fit: Larger SMEs and lower mid-market businesses (100–2,000 FTE) wanting a persistent platform with a named advisor, not just self-serve software.
10. Flotilla
What they do: UK B Corp carbon platform for SMEs integrating with finance and HR systems to deliver full Scope 1/2/3 footprints, PPN 006 / SECR / CRPs and decarbonisation action libraries, backed by an advisory team. flotillaworld.com
Differentiators: Advisory board chaired by UK Climate Change Committee Chair Piers Forster; strong construction-sector traction; B Corp certified; API integrations with Sage, Xero and QuickBooks; structured decarbonisation action libraries for SMEs who have the footprint data but don't know what to do next.
Best fit: SMEs working toward B Corp certification, or construction SMEs needing a structured action library alongside their compliance documents.
How to choose between them
Start from the trigger, then narrow by business size and how much ongoing reporting you need. The two most common starting points:
Path A — "I just need a carbon footprint / Scope 3 number for a customer"
A standalone carbon footprint for customer disclosure, B Corp, EcoVadis or voluntary reporting — no tender involved. Shortlist:
- Want a single fixed price & named consultant → The Carbon Stamp or Green Business
- Already on Xero / Sage / QuickBooks → EcoHedge, Seedling or Flotilla
- Sector-specific (travel, food, events) → ecollective
Path B — "I'm bidding on a public-sector tender"
You need a footprint and a PPN 006 Carbon Reduction Plan together, formatted for procurement evaluation. Shortlist:
- Fixed-fee one-off, no software → The Carbon Stamp, Litmus or C Free
- NHS Supply Chain or Crown Commercial Service specifically → C Free, Litmus, NetZero Group or The Carbon Stamp
- Manufacturing or NHS mid-market with platform needs → NetZero Group or Flotilla
- Ongoing fractional support beyond the tender → SBS or ecollective
- B Corp certification path alongside the CRP → Flotilla or SBS
The consultant vs. platform cost distinction matters: if you need a signed report for a single tender, a fixed-fee one-off engagement is almost always cheaper than 12 months of platform subscription access. If you're reporting annually and tracking progress against reduction targets, a platform starts to make economic sense once the initial assessment is done.

How much should an SME budget for a carbon consultant?
Most UK SMEs spend between £600 and £6,000+VAT for a one-off engagement covering Scope 1, 2 and material Scope 3 emissions plus a PPN 006-compliant Carbon Reduction Plan. The range is wide because cost scales with headcount, number of sites and how deep your Scope 3 analysis needs to go.
